What is "Conditioning Your Body"?

"Conditioning your body" extends beyond simply exercising; it is the strategic and progressive development of your physical systems to improve their functional capacity and resilience. It's about preparing your body to meet the demands of daily life, specific sports, or any physical challenge with efficiency, strength, and reduced risk of injury. True conditioning encompasses multiple interlinked components, each vital for a well-rounded and robust physique.

The Pillars of Effective Body Conditioning

A comprehensive body conditioning program addresses several key physiological attributes:

  • Cardiovascular Endurance: This refers to your heart, lungs, and circulatory system's ability to supply oxygen to working muscles efficiently during sustained physical activity.

    • Training Methods:
      • Low-Intensity Steady State (LISS): Activities like brisk walking, cycling, or swimming for longer durations at a moderate pace.
      • High-Intensity Interval Training (HIIT): Short bursts of intense anaerobic exercise followed by brief recovery periods.
    • Benefits: Improved heart health, increased stamina, enhanced fat metabolism.
  • Muscular Strength & Endurance:

    • Muscular Strength: The maximum force a muscle or muscle group can exert in a single effort.
    • Muscular Endurance: The ability of a muscle or muscle group to perform repeated contractions against a resistance, or to sustain a contraction for an extended period.
    • Training Methods:
      • Resistance Training: Using free weights, machines, resistance bands, or bodyweight exercises.
      • Progressive Overload: Gradually increasing the weight, repetitions, sets, or decreasing rest times to continually challenge muscles.
    • Benefits: Increased power, improved metabolism, stronger bones, better posture, reduced injury risk.
  • Flexibility & Mobility:

    • Flexibility: The absolute range of movement in a joint or series of joints.
    • Mobility: The ability to move a joint through its full range of motion actively and with control.
    • Training Methods:
      • Static Stretching: Holding a stretch for 15-60 seconds, typically post-workout.
      • Dynamic Stretching: Controlled, fluid movements that take joints through their full range of motion, often used as a warm-up.
      • Foam Rolling/Self-Myofascial Release: Addressing muscle tightness and trigger points.
    • Benefits: Improved range of motion, reduced muscle stiffness, enhanced movement patterns, injury prevention.
  • Neuromuscular Control & Balance: This involves the communication between your brain, nervous system, and muscles, enabling coordinated, stable, and efficient movement.

    • Training Methods:
      • Balance Exercises: Standing on one leg, using unstable surfaces (e.g., wobble boards).
      • Plyometrics: Explosive movements like jumping and hopping that train power and reactivity.
      • Agility Drills: Changing direction quickly and efficiently.
    • Benefits: Enhanced coordination, improved stability, quicker reaction times, reduced fall risk.
  • Body Composition: While not a training method itself, optimizing body composition (the ratio of lean mass to fat mass) is a critical outcome of effective conditioning, influencing performance and overall health. It is primarily influenced by a combination of resistance training, cardiovascular exercise, and crucially, nutrition.

Designing Your Conditioning Program: Key Principles

Effective body conditioning is built upon several foundational exercise science principles:

  • Individualization: Your program must be tailored to your current fitness level, health status, goals, and any pre-existing conditions. What works for one person may not be optimal for another.
  • Specificity (SAID Principle): The body adapts specifically to the demands placed upon it. If you want to run faster, you run; if you want to lift heavier, you lift heavy. Your training should mimic the movements and energy systems required for your goals.
  • Progressive Overload: To continue making gains, you must consistently increase the demands on your body. This can mean more weight, more repetitions, more sets, longer duration, or reduced rest. Without progressive overload, adaptations plateau.
  • Periodization: Structuring your training into phases (e.g., hypertrophy, strength, power, maintenance) with varying intensity and volume to optimize performance, prevent overtraining, and promote long-term adaptation.
  • Recovery & Adaptation: Training creates microscopic damage and fatigue. It is during rest, sleep, and proper nutrition that your body repairs, rebuilds, and adapts, becoming stronger and more conditioned. Neglecting recovery leads to diminishing returns and increased injury risk.
  • Consistency: Sporadic effort yields minimal results. Regular, consistent engagement with your conditioning program is the single most important factor for long-term success.

Practical Steps to Get Started

Embarking on a body conditioning journey requires a structured approach:

  1. Assess Your Starting Point:

    • Medical Clearance: Consult your doctor, especially if you have pre-existing health conditions or haven't exercised regularly.
    • Fitness Assessment: Perform baseline tests (e.g., 1-mile run, push-up test, sit-and-reach) to understand your current fitness level in various domains. This provides a benchmark for progress.
  2. Define Your Goals:

    • Set S.M.A.R.T. goals: Specific, Measurable, Achievable, Relevant, Time-bound. Examples: "Run a 5K in under 30 minutes in 12 weeks," or "Increase my squat 1-rep max by 15% in 3 months."
  3. Choose Your Activities:

    • Select activities you enjoy and that align with your goals. This promotes adherence. Incorporate a mix of cardiovascular, strength, and flexibility/mobility work.
  4. Structure Your Week:

    • A balanced program often includes:
      • 2-4 days of resistance training: Targeting major muscle groups, ensuring adequate rest between sessions for the same muscle group.
      • 3-5 days of cardiovascular training: A mix of LISS and potentially HIIT, depending on goals and fitness level.
      • Daily flexibility/mobility work: Short sessions (5-15 minutes) can be highly effective.
      • Dedicated rest days: Crucial for recovery.
  5. Prioritize Nutrition & Hydration:

    • Fuel your body with a balanced diet rich in lean protein, complex carbohydrates, healthy fats, vitamins, and minerals.
    • Maintain adequate hydration by drinking water throughout the day, especially before, during, and after exercise.
  6. Listen to Your Body:

    • Distinguish between muscle soreness (DOMS) and pain. If you experience sharp, persistent pain, stop and assess.
    • Recognize signs of overtraining (e.g., chronic fatigue, decreased performance, irritability, disrupted sleep) and adjust your program accordingly.
  7. Seek Professional Guidance:

    • Consider working with a certified personal trainer or strength and conditioning specialist. They can design a customized program, teach proper form, and provide ongoing motivation and accountability.
    • For specific injuries or limitations, consult a physical therapist or other healthcare professional.
